I am an artist, based in rural southern Scotland. Trained as a fine art printmaker, I completed my postgraduate studies at Glasgow School of Art. My art work is inspired by the colours of nature and a vivid imagination. I also have a keen interest in nature and the environment which is reflected in my love of gardening and plants. Many of my images are based on plants from my own garden. As well as a keen interest in plants I also have a love of exotic and colourful birds and sometimes combine these with my plant drawings.
Each piece of work is hand drawn working from black to white before the colours are added. Complex pieces can take several weeks to complete.
